The DeKalb County Sheriff’s Mounted Unit, organized in 2002 by then Lt. Jimmy Harris, is a volunteer organization now headed by Commander Jonathan Langley. The members of the Mounted Unit are regular or reserve deputies who give their time to assist the Sheriff in providing security and conducting searches in DeKalb County and Northeast Alabama. The Mounted Unit has participated in numerous search, rescue, and apprehend operations, and has provides security at Talladega Speedway and other venues.
